Job ID: 114545 The Leonardo DRS Land Systems business is a recognized leader in the design and integration of complex technologies into new and legacy systems and platforms for global military and commercial customers. We are a 5 year running Top Workplace in the Greater St. Louis area. Job Summary Leonardo DRS Land Systems is seeking a full time Senior Manager of Business Development. This position is based out of our Bridgeton, MO facility and will have the option to work a hybrid schedule or a remote worker. This position reports to the Mission Support Director of Business Development. Responsibilities include lead identification, opportunity qualification, customer relationship management, pursue/no-pursue decision briefs, and capture strategy for new opportunities. The position requires frequent travel (~30-40%) to support customer visits, trade shows, conferences, and equipment demonstrations/testing. The successful candidate demonstrates high integrity, proactively builds new skills, and independently drives work to meet program goals and business objectives. Job Responsibilities Manage and conduct the evaluation and implementation of new initiatives and business opportunities for the Company under the direction of senior business development leader or site leader Provide strategic and tactical direction to the business development function by evaluating new initiatives and business opportunities Conduct and may oversee the market analysis and competitive activity Identify and explore customer needs Provide assistance in the planning, designing, and implementing of business plans Assist with the follow through and deployment of the Company's vision, strategies, and tactics Coordinate and facilitate activities and commitments with other departments and/or functions Develop and track project schedules Participate/coordinate in strategic alliances and other external business relationships May manage Business Development staff Support, communicate, reinforce, and defend the mission, values and culture of the organization Make presentations on Company portfolio of products and services Attend business meetings as requested Attend trade shows Analyze and have general understanding of the Government budgeting process

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or Engineering or related discipline or equivalent combination of education and experience 10+ years of relevant experience Master’s degree preferred Strong interpersonal, verbal, written and presentation communication skills Planning and organization, project management, and time management skills Proposal development and Shipley process experience Capture management experience General business acumen Strong analytical and financial skills Ability to solve complex problems Knowledge of defense markets and technology DoD experience is preferred Willing and able to travel between 30-40% of the time The salary range for this position is $130,828.00/year - $176,618.00/year for the states of Illinois and Minessota, $143,911.00/year - $194,280.00/year for the state of Washington, and $150,452.00/year - $203,111.00/year for the state of California.
